Longer application of kinesio taping would be beneficial for exercise-induced muscle damage

Kinesio taping (KT) has been widely used to prevent muscle pain and to improve range of motion in clinical settings. However, no previous re-search has examined how long KT should be applied to muscle follow-ing damaging exercise. The aim of this study was to investigate the ef-fect of the duration of KT application on markers of muscle damage fol-lowing eccentric exercise. Thirty-two male subjects participated in the study and were randomly assigned to one of the following groups: con-trol (CON), KT-post, KT-30 min, or KT-24 hr. Eccentric exercise consisted of 2 sets of 25 contractions of elbow flexors using the non-dominant arm. Maximal isometric strength, muscle soreness (SOR), range of mo-tion, and creatine kinase activity were measured before,immediately after, and at 24, 48, 72, and 96 hr after exercise. The KT-24 hr group showed lesser muscle damage and a faster recovery time than the CON and KT-post groups. Both the KT-30 min and KT-24 hr groups showed lesser SOR than CON and KT-post groups. These findings sug-gested that prolonged application of KT had a positive effect on mark-ers of muscle damage.
